
Kyrgyzstan Customs Service Sees Rise in Tax Revenue Plan for 2025

Tax revenue plan for 2025 for Customs Service of Kyrgyzstan increased
The plan for tax revenues for 2025 for the Customs Service of Kyrgyzstan has been increased by 800 million soms, according to the approved republican budget.
Initially, the Ministry of Finance had forecasted tax revenues of the State Customs Service to be at the level of 127.6 billion soms. However, the latest update has raised this figure to 128.4 billion soms. The increase in the plan is attributed to the collection of VAT on imports of goods from third countries, which has been raised.
The tax on goods from states that are not members of the Eurasian Economic Union (EAEU) will contribute to the higher revenue target for the Customs Service in 2025.
